# Hex Cartographer [![ko-fi](https://ko-fi.com/img/githubbutton_sm.svg)](https://ko-fi.com/christophwerner) **Bring Your Fantasy Worlds to Life** Hex Cartographer is a visual hex map editor for [Obsidian](https://obsidian.md). Create detailed fantasy world maps with colored hex tiles, hand-crafted SVG symbols, rivers, roads, borders, and text annotations — all stored as plain text in your vault. Your finished maps can be printed or exported as high-resolution PNG/JPEG images — perfect for RPG game masters, fantasy authors, and worldbuilders. ## Example Map ![Example Map](readmedata/hc-maps-westeros.png) ## Symbols Library ![Symbols Library](readmedata/hc-symbols-library.png) ## Editor ![Editor](readmedata/hc-editor-001.png) ## Features #### Hex Grid Editor - Infinite scrollable hex grid canvas - Paint hexes with custom colors and palettes - Color eyedropper to pick colors from the map - Fill tool for quick area painting - Pattern stamp tool to apply repeating tile layouts - Change map orientation to get flat top hexagons instead of pointy top #### Symbols & Terrain - 25+ hand-crafted SVG symbols across 4 groups: Extras, Vegetation, Mountains, Buildings - Symbols inherit the active master color for full flexibility - Right-click to switch between symbol variants #### Rivers, Roads & Borders - Draw rivers and roads by placing waypoints - Adjustable line width and dash patterns - Rivers taper naturally at dead ends - Draw border regions with customizable styles - Toggle border visibility on/off #### Text Annotations - Place text labels anywhere on the map - Customize font size, color, bold, and italic - Link text to other notes in your Obsidian vault #### Export & Print - Export maps as high-resolution PNG or JPEG - Print directly from the three-dot menu - On mobile, exports are saved next to the map file #### Full Mobile Support - Touch-optimized: tap to place, swipe to draw - Two-finger pinch to zoom, two-finger drag to pan - Long-press on tool buttons for variant selection ## Installation 1. Open Obsidian Settings 2. Go to **Community Plugins** and disable **Restricted Mode** 3. Click **Browse** and search for **Hex Cartographer** 4. Click **Install**, then **Enable** #### Manual Installation 1. Download `main.js`, `styles.css`, and `manifest.json` from the [latest release](https://github.com/Taroslord/Hex-Cartographer/releases) 2. Create a folder `hex-cartographer` in your vault's `.obsidian/plugins/` directory 3. Place the downloaded files inside 4. Restart Obsidian and enable the plugin ## Getting Started 1. Right-click a folder in the file explorer and select **Create new Hex Cartographer Map** 2. Toggle **Edit Mode** to start drawing 3. Select a color from the palette and click hexes to paint terrain 4. Switch tool groups in the toolbar to place symbols, draw paths, or add text 5. Use **Ctrl+Z** / **Ctrl+Y** to undo and redo ## Controls | Action | Desktop | Mobile | |--------|---------|--------| | Paint / Place | Left-click | Tap | | Erase | Right-click (hold + drag for multiple) | Eraser Icon | | Erase all | Double right-click | Eraser Icon, then double tap| | Zoom | Mouse wheel | Two-finger pinch | | Pan | Middle mouse / Shift+Drag | Two-finger drag | | Symbol variant | Right-click tool button | Long-press tool button | | Palette color | Right-click palette slot | Long-press palette slot | | Undo | Ctrl+Z | Undo Icon | | Redo | Ctrl+Y | Redo Icon | ## Languages **Hex Cartographer supports 11 languages**. The language is automatically detected from your Obsidian settings. German, English, Chinese, Russian, Japanese, French, Portuguese, Korean, Spanish, Polish, Italian ## License This plugin is licensed under the [GNU General Public License v3.0](LICENSE). --- [![ko-fi](https://ko-fi.com/img/githubbutton_sm.svg)](https://ko-fi.com/christophwerner)
